2010 MFI CTP3 Safety Overview
The 2010 MFI CTP3 has been closely monitored for safety issues.
Official NHTSA Recalls
The NHTSA has issued 1 official safety recall for this vehicle. Key affected components include:
- Service brakes, hydraulic
Severe Defect Warnings
Notably, some of these defects carry severe risks, such as leakage of brake fluid and/or the presence of air in brake lines may cause the brakes to not operate as intended increasing the risk of a crash.
